CoreView Raises Kanzhun Stake to 24.27% of AUM with $220.7M Purchase

CoreView Capital bought 298,584 shares of Kanzhun, boosting its stake to 9.45 million shares valued at $220.7 million, or 24.27% of its assets under management. Kanzhun posted TTM revenue of $1.09 billion and net income of $304 million through June 2025, with its shares up 51.4% over the past year.

1. CoreView Capital Boosts Position in Kanzhun

A recent SEC filing dated November 13, 2025, shows CoreView Capital Management Ltd acquired an additional 298,584 shares of Kanzhun Limited, raising its total holding to 9,447,889 shares. This purchase increases Kanzhun’s weighting to 24.27% of CoreView’s reportable U.S. equity assets, making it the fund’s largest single position by AUM. The stake is now valued at approximately $220.70 million as of the end of Q3 2025, up from a 21.3% allocation in the prior quarter.

2. Strong Profitability Underscores Earnings Momentum

Kanzhun’s trailing twelve-month revenue reached $1.09 billion through June 30, 2025, while net income totaled $304.08 million over the same period. These figures mark a sustained uptick in profitability, driven by robust demand for the company’s BOSS Zhipin platform. The online recruitment marketplace has demonstrated an ability to convert increased user engagement into higher fee-based revenues from corporate clients, underpinning the company’s shift toward consistent positive free cash flow.

3. Market Leadership in China’s Online Recruitment

As operator of China’s largest digital hiring platform, Kanzhun connects employers of all sizes—from SMEs to large enterprises—with job seekers through a suite of recruitment services. Its monetization model combines base listing fees, premium access subscriptions and value-added services. The platform’s emphasis on rapid response times and high match quality has fueled year-over-year user growth, reinforcing its market share amid a competitive landscape that includes established job boards and emerging AI-driven hiring solutions.
